Examining the Results of Gates Foundation's Small-School Initiative

The Institute for Education and the Arts posts this article about the progress of the Gates Foundation’s small schools initiatives.

FOUNDATION’S SMALL-SCHOOLS EXPERIMENT HAS YET TO YIELD BIG RESULTS
Linda Shaw, The Seattle Times, November 5, 2006
“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ation outgoing Executive Director of Education Giving Tom Vander Ark admits that his group's efforts to promote small schools since 1999 have proven more complicated than initially envisioned, although he believes most of the grant-winning schools are better off today than they were before they reformed. The foundation now is focusing on giving high schools more instructional support, rather than simply making them autonomous.”
